Prof. Cheng Wang earned his Bachelor’s degree from the Department of Surveying Engineering, Hohai University, in 1998, his Master’s degree from the School of Geographical Sciences, Nanjing Normal University Master of Science in 2001, and his PhD degree from Louis Pasteur University, France, in 2005. He is currently a researcher at the Institute of Space Information Innovation, Chinese Academy of Sciences. His research interests include LiDAR remote sensing, remote sensing information extraction, and multidisciplinary comprehensive application.
